欢迎光临青冈雍途茂网络有限公司司官网!
全国咨询热线:13583364057
当前位置: 首页 > 新闻动态

高效跨平台数据序列化与TCP传输策略

时间:2025-11-28 18:38:00

高效跨平台数据序列化与TCP传输策略
根据排序后的键,从 defaultdict 中提取出最终的分组列表。
保持PHP环境的最新状态对于确保应用程序的稳定性和可维护性至关重要。
日志监控与分析: PHP错误日志:前面提到的error_log文件,要定期查看。
strings.Join 函数不会修改原始的字符串切片。
如果用户自定义的标签也是整数,那么就会与元素的 ID 发生冲突,导致 delete() 方法无法正确识别要删除的对象。
最后,将处理后的行重新组合成一个新的DataFrame。
解决方案:单一target_metadata和模型导入 正确的做法是让target_metadata指向你统一的Base实例所持有的MetaData对象。
Swapface人脸交换 一款创建逼真人脸交换的AI换脸工具 45 查看详情 使用c_str()成员函数可以获取指向内部字符串的const char*指针: std::string str = "Hello, World!"; const char* charArray = str.c_str(); std::cout << charArray << std::endl; 如果需要可修改的char数组,可以使用strcpy配合分配空间: char* mutableArray = new char[str.length() + 1]; strcpy(mutableArray, str.c_str()); // 使用完记得释放 delete[] mutableArray; 或者使用更安全的std::copy: char buffer[256]; std::copy(str.begin(), str.end(), buffer); buffer[str.size()] = '\0'; 注意事项 转换时需要注意几点: 确保char数组以'\0'结尾,否则std::string无法正确判断长度 c_str()返回的是const char*,不能修改其内容 string对象生命周期结束后,c_str()返回的指针将失效 手动分配的char数组需及时释放,避免内存泄漏 基本上就这些。
NegaMax的核心思想是,无论当前是哪个玩家的回合,都尝试最大化当前玩家的得分。
微信 WeLM WeLM不是一个直接的对话机器人,而是一个补全用户输入信息的生成模型。
该错误通常源于用户凭据不匹配、用户不存在或权限不足,尤其在数据库迁移后更为常见。
示例: 立即进入“豆包AI人工智官网入口”; 立即学习“豆包AI人工智能在线问答入口”; func counter() func() int { i := 0 return func() int { i++ return i } } 上面的例子中,变量 i 被闭包捕获。
这避免了为少量代码创建额外应用带来的管理开销。
如果一个值能用 static constexpr 定义,那就优先使用它,因为它提供了更多的编译时检查和优化潜力。
即构数智人 即构数智人是由即构科技推出的AI虚拟数字人视频创作平台,支持数字人形象定制、短视频创作、数字人直播等。
定义二叉树节点结构 在开始前,先定义一个基本的二叉树节点结构: struct TreeNode { int val; TreeNode* left; TreeNode* right; TreeNode(int x) : val(x), left(nullptr), right(nullptr) {} }; 方法一:递归实现 递归是最直观的方式,按照“左→右→根”的顺序访问节点。
理解它们的区别是解决策略调用问题的关键。
它常用于网络传输、文件存储等场景以减少数据体积。
打印时机: current += 1 或 current -= 1 发生在 print 语句之前,确保了打印出的 current 值是电梯移动后的新楼层。
") print(f"总计有 {modified_files_count} 个文件被修改。

本文链接:http://www.altodescuento.com/19969_4399c4.html